The OPA4820IDG4 is a voltage-feedback operational amplifier that amplifies and conditions input signals. It utilizes a high-speed, low-noise architecture to provide accurate amplification across a wide range of frequencies. The amplifier operates by comparing the voltage difference between its non-inverting (IN+) and inverting (IN-) inputs and amplifying this difference according to its gain settings. The amplified signal is then available at the output pin (OUT) for further processing.
